Amazon warrior tribes capture and strip men carrying out illegal logging


Fed up of inaction from the Brazilian authorities, the Ka’apor Indian tribe of Amazonian warriors have captured, tied-up and stripped loggers – it seems these loggers were illegally destroying their land in the Brazilian rainforest news.sky.com.
Incidentally, the Ka'apor Indians along with four other tribes, are the legal inhabitants and caretakers of the Alto Turiacu Indian territory in the Amazonian basin.
In a bid to control the illegal logging, they have been dispatching their warriors to expel all loggers and set up monitoring camps in the areas illegally exploited. These warriors have also set fire to the trucks of the loggers and have used chainsaws to ruin the logs they found. Later, they later released the loggers.,br> It seems the Brazilian authorities have reportedly broken up a criminal organization which was believed to be the single "biggest destroyer" of the rainforest. This gang had been accused of invading public land to carrying out illegal logging apart from setting fire to clear large areas so they could sell them for grazing or cultivation.
As per the Brazilian police, the gang was responsible for $222m of damage and are facing charges of forgery, conspiracy, money laundering, tax invasion, theft and environmental crimes.
